Comprehending Floor Robots
Floor robotics, typically called robotic vacuums or floor cleaners, automate the process of cleaning floorings in residential and commercial areas. They make use of a mix of sensors, mapping technology, and synthetic intelligence to browse, determine dirt, and tidy numerous types of surface areas. This development not only saves time but also enhances the efficiency of cleaning efforts.
How Do Floor Robots Work?
Floor robots operate through a mix of software and hardware components created to optimize their cleaning capabilities. Below is a streamlined overview of their operational process:
-
Mapping and Navigation:
- Using Lidar, electronic cameras, or infrared sensing units, the robot creates a map of the area.
- It determines and avoids challenges, ensuring effective navigation.
-
Cleaning Mechanics:
- Most floor robots are geared up with turning brushes or suction systems to collect debris.
- They can differ their cleaning modes based upon the type of surface (carpet, tile, and so on).
-
Dirt Detection:
- Advanced designs make use of dirt-detection sensing units to determine greatly stained areas and tidy them more thoroughly.
-
Self-Charging:
- Once cleaning is total or the battery runs low, numerous robots automatically return to their charging stations.
-
App Integration:
- Many floor robotics feature mobile applications that enable users to schedule cleaning sessions, set cleaning modes, and screen development.

Kinds Of Floor Robots
There are a number of types of floor robots available on the marketplace, each developed to deal with different needs:
Type of Floor Robot | Description | Best Usage |
---|---|---|
Robotic Vacuums | Mainly created for vacuuming carpets and difficult floors. | Everyday cleaning of different surface areas. |
Robotic Mops | Equipped with a mopping feature for wet cleaning. | Ideal for tough surface areas requiring damp cleaning. |
Combo Robots | Combines vacuuming and mopping functionalities. | Flexible cleaning for a variety of surfaces. |
Specialty Robots | Developed for particular tasks (e.g., pet hair removal). | Houses with animals or specific cleaning requirements. |
Factors to consider When Buying a Floor Robot
Purchasing a floor robot involves numerous factors to consider to make sure that the selected model satisfies the cleaning requirements. Below are some elements to keep in mind:
-
Floor Type:
- Consider whether the robot appropriates for carpets, hardwood, tile, or a mix of floor covering types.
-
Battery Life:
- Evaluate the robot’s battery duration to identify how long it can clean up before requiring a recharge.
-
Suction Power:
- Higher suction power is vital for efficient cleaning, particularly on carpets.
-
Navigation System:
- A sophisticated navigation system adds to efficient cleaning patterns and much better challenge avoidance.
-
Dustbin Capacity:
- Larger dustbins require less frequent emptying, which is convenient for users.
-
Smart Features:
- Look for designs with Wi-Fi connectivity, app support, and voice control compatibility for included convenience.
